This is the adorable moment a ‘real life bambi and thumper’ were spotted hiking through the.
Wild Bambi Doe Videos: Authentic Wildlife Footage
This is the adorable moment a 'real life bambi and thumper' were spotted hiking through the....
This is the adorable moment a ‘real life bambi and thumper’ were spotted hiking through the.